Key Responsibilities:
- Act as the CEO’s right hand, managing a dynamic calendar, coordinating travel, and ensuring seamless transitions between high-impact meetings and events.
- Prepare briefing materials and agendas for key meetings, keeping the CEO informed and aligned on priorities.
- Serve as a professional liaison for incoming requests, communicating with impeccable business etiquette and actively participating in initiatives to troubleshoot and resolve issues.
- Track action items, follow-ups, and key deliverables across internal and external stakeholders.
- Collaborate closely with the administrative team and broader staff to maintain aligned schedules, shared resources, and consistent organizational support.

What We’re Looking For:
- Seasoned. You have worked for CEO-level Executives for at least five years or more.
- Master of prioritization. You excel at prioritizing and managing your time strategically, adapting to shifting demands with ease.
- Exceptional communicator. You can convey ideas clearly in writing and verbally, build strong relationships, and represent the CEO with professionalism.
- Tech-savvy. You are comfortable with office software, virtual collaboration tools, and learning new systems quickly.
- Mission-driven. You are energized by working in a global nonprofit environment and aligning your work to support organizational goals.
